Removal from the Norwich and Peterborough Building Society and other lender panels: Why they do it and how to get reinstated

  • Your law firm fails to meet the criteria to remain on the Norwich and Peterborough Building Society conveyancing panel
  • Breaches of Norwich and Peterborough Building Society conveyancing panel requirements
  • Norwich and Peterborough Building Society may terminate membership of its conveyancing panel where a firm fails to provide any relevant information or provide incorrect information in its application form or in relation to any future requests for information.
  • Persistent delays in registering security on behalf of Norwich and Peterborough Building Society Delays or failure to register the Norwich and Peterborough Building Society charge may result in referral to external lawyers of Norwich and Peterborough Building Society to complete outstanding requirements.
